Transaction 67289e9bdb8664c71b90b40261484ce71850f10500a963df3e5fffe70f2814ac
1 Input
1 Output
-
67289e9bdb8664c71b90b40261484ce71850f10500a963df3e5fffe70f2814ac:0
- value
- 3311064
- script pubkey
- OP_0 OP_PUSHBYTES_20 df8a070a763ff6f52153f001a18548d5e8cc2ab4
- address
- bc1qm79qwznk8lm02g2n7qq6rp2g6h5vc245wk7dl6